Order the free 10 pack and see what I mean.&lt;br/&gt;    &lt;/p&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/7465430981598777386-6603690483912896702?l=crazy-ivory.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://crazy-ivory.blogspot.com/feeds/6603690483912896702/comments/default' title='Kommentare zum Post'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://www.blogger.com/comment.g?blogID=7465430981598777386&amp;postID=6603690483912896702' title='0 Kommentare'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/7465430981598777386/posts/default/6603690483912896702'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/7465430981598777386/posts/default/6603690483912896702'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://crazy-ivory.blogspot.com/2009/10/prints.html' title='Prints'/><author><name>Crazy-Ivory</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/09726101609286036456</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='32' height='21' src='http://1.bp.blogspot.com/_PILcsZ7hZUU/SizHPdrVkaI/AAAAAAAAAC4/kwXAFWb9AmM/s1600-R/3570842121_dafebbc983_m.jpg'/></author><media:thumbnail xmlns:media='http://search.yahoo.com/mrss/' url='http://farm3.static.flickr.com/2632/4001114585_28879a6bb6_t.jpg' height='72' width='72'/><thr:total>0</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-7465430981598777386.post-6937083040272941092</id><published>2009-07-22T21:52:00.000+02:00</published><updated>2009-07-27T16:41:30.823+02:00</updated><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='specials'/><title type='text'>CF Card Problems</title><content type='html'>&lt;div xmlns='http://www.w3.org/1999/xhtml'&gt;&lt;p&gt;This post is a summary of the things that happened to me during the last weeks regarding CF Cards.&lt;/p&gt;    &lt;h3&gt;&lt;strong&gt;Part 1:  &lt;font color='#CC0000'&gt;Image Errors&lt;/font&gt;&lt;/strong&gt;&lt;/h3&gt;    &lt;p&gt;As I wrote on &lt;a href='http://www.flickr.com/photos/crazy-ivory/3720254538/'&gt;Flickr before&lt;/a&gt; I had massive problems with my CF card. I only have got one and this one didnt let me down since I own my camera(more than a year now). During the last weeks more and more images that I transfered to my pc were broken. That means that they look like this when I open them in Camera Raw:&lt;/p&gt;    &lt;p&gt;&lt;img src='http://farm3.static.flickr.com/2597/3718695856_99ac82b770.jpg' width='500' height='333'/&gt;&lt;/p&gt;    &lt;p&gt;I thought about what could have caused this problem, read through the internet and arrived at the conclusion that this erros have to be a CF Card problem. &lt;/p&gt;    &lt;p&gt;The biggest problem was that I couldnt see if an image is broken or not when I viewed them on camera because all images seemed to be ok when I viewed them there. How is that possible? Every RAW file has a little jpeg in it which is used as a thumbnail so that the camera doesnt have to load the big RAW files all the time. Those jpegs were ok but the real RAW file was broken so all I had were these little jpegs. Not acceptable for me.&lt;/p&gt;    &lt;p&gt;These problems       occured shortly before I went on holidays so I borrowed two CF cards from a friend of mine and used them in these holidays. Today I came back and transfered all the shots from camera to pc. I was surprised and confused when I realized that not only the RAW files from my CF card, but even from both borrowed CF cards had broken RAWs. This was not       explainable with a broken CF card so I had to think about this again.&lt;/p&gt;    &lt;p&gt;&lt;strong&gt;I instantly realized the reason for that. I had read something on the internet that explained all that. Not my CF Card but my internal CF card readers is broken. I tried to transfer the images using an external USB Card reader and it worked. No broken Raw files anymore. Pretty crazy&lt;/strong&gt;.&lt;/p&gt;    &lt;p&gt;So if you are finding damaged Raw files among your shots dont worry. Just try another CF card reader and it might help. In my case it did.&lt;/p&gt;        &lt;h1&gt;&lt;strong&gt;&lt;font color='#0099FF'&gt;Please scroll down for the update!&lt;/font&gt;&lt;/strong&gt;&lt;/h1&gt;      &lt;h3&gt;&lt;strong&gt;Part 2: &lt;font color='#CC0000'&gt;CF Card scamming on Amazon&lt;/font&gt;&lt;/strong&gt;&lt;/h3&gt;    &lt;p&gt;&lt;font color='#000000'&gt;When I realized &lt;/font&gt;those damaged RAW files I instantly thought that my CF card would be broken. I would be really interested to read about that!&lt;/p&gt;    &lt;p&gt;&lt;strong&gt;&lt;font color='#0099FF'&gt;Please see Update 2 below for an important update.&lt;/font&gt;&lt;/strong&gt;&lt;/p&gt;    &lt;p&gt; &lt;/p&gt;          &lt;h1&gt;&lt;font color='#0099FF'&gt;&lt;strong&gt;Update 1 :&lt;/strong&gt;&lt;/font&gt;&lt;/h1&gt;        &lt;p&gt;The problems occured again and I started to search for the reason again. It seemed to not be the CF Card reader because the problems even occured when I copied images from a USB stick to hard disc. I called a pc service agent and he told me that it could be a damaged RAM Memory. I exchanged my 4GB RAM for the 1 GB that were originally delivered with my pc and the problems didnt occure again.&lt;/p&gt;      &lt;p&gt;Then I ran memtest which is a little, free program that tests the RAM. It is really helpful because it shows you whether the RAM are working good or if they are producing writing errors. Perfectly working RAM should deliver a test results without any errors. After one hour of testing my RAM delivered 8 writing errors.         These errors can show up pretty versatile while working on the pc. In my case the errors occured when I copied RAW images and so some image copies were broken after copying because such a RAM error occured while copying this file. I now         complained my RAM and got new ones and they work perfectly. No errors or broken images since exchanging them.&lt;/p&gt;      &lt;p&gt;&lt;font color='#CC0000'&gt;edited 27-07-2009 - 01:49&lt;/font&gt;&lt;/p&gt;      &lt;p&gt; &lt;/p&gt;      &lt;h1&gt;&lt;font color='#0099FF'&gt;&lt;strong&gt;Update 2 :&lt;/strong&gt;&lt;/font&gt;&lt;/h1&gt;      &lt;p&gt;I asked Extrememory to check the warranty number of the CF Card that deleted my images and they told me that it is valid. The reason for that is that I got such an invitation recently and at the moment I have no idea what to do.&lt;/p&gt;      &lt;p&gt;A short information for all who dont know what I am talking about:&lt;/p&gt;    &lt;p&gt;Some month ago our good old friend flickr signed up a deal with the world's "biggest supplier of pictures and video to media and advertising companies" Getty Images to combine their businesses. In reality this means that Getty searches through the big flickr universe and invites images of which they think that they are suitable for selling to their stock. The terms for that are reason for many controversial arguments these days. A photographer that wants his work to appear in the Getty stock has to give all selling rights to Getty what means that he is not more allowed to sell his work on his own for the time of the contract (2 years). If a photographer agrees he gets 20-30% of every image that is sold without having any costs. Many professionals bring forward the argument that they get at least 40% if they give their images to other stocks. I am not really into all these professional photography selling things but what I think is that for all the persons that do photography only as a hobby this is good way to get a bit of extra money out of their stuff.&lt;/p&gt;    &lt;p&gt;So, why am I unsure about adding my images? Over and out.&lt;br/&gt;                &lt;/p&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/7465430981598777386-6473648745838443601?l=crazy-ivory.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://crazy-ivory.blogspot.com/feeds/6473648745838443601/comments/default' title='Kommentare zum Post'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://www.blogger.com/comment.g?blogID=7465430981598777386&amp;postID=6473648745838443601' title='1 Kommentare'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/7465430981598777386/posts/default/6473648745838443601'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/7465430981598777386/posts/default/6473648745838443601'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://crazy-ivory.blogspot.com/2009/04/1-year-on-flickr.html' title='1 Year on Flickr'/><author><name>Crazy-Ivory</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/09726101609286036456</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='32' height='21' src='http://1.bp.blogspot.com/_PILcsZ7hZUU/SizHPdrVkaI/AAAAAAAAAC4/kwXAFWb9AmM/s1600-R/3570842121_dafebbc983_m.jpg'/></author><media:thumbnail xmlns:media='http://search.yahoo.com/mrss/' url='http://farm3.static.flickr.com/2192/2433346937_69559f007d_t.jpg' height='72' width='72'/><thr:total>1</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-7465430981598777386.post-3753653446393105902</id><published>2009-04-19T15:15:00.001+02:00</published><updated>2009-04-19T15:18:03.646+02:00</updated><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='tutorials'/><title type='text'>Through Binoculars</title><content type='html'>&lt;div xmlns='http://www.w3.org/1999/xhtml'&gt;&lt;p&gt;To underline my most recent image &lt;font color='#CC0033'&gt;&lt;a href='http://www.flickr.com/photos/crazy-ivory/3454984891/'&gt;"Through Binoculars"&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/font&gt; I wanted to tell you something about the way this image has been achieved and a bit about this technique in general.&lt;/p&gt;    &lt;p&gt;To begin with I will tell you what I used. &lt;/p&gt;    &lt;p&gt;I used my Canon EOS 400D in connection with the 18-55mm Kit Lens and binoculars of a brand I dont know. All I know about them is that they are about 200 EUR. You will need some pretty good binoculars to work with, I tried it with small and cheap ones but it didnt work at all. It is important that the peephole is big enough because if its not you will have a black circle frame which limits the sight.&lt;/p&gt;    &lt;p&gt;&lt;a href='http://flickr.com/gp/crazy-ivory/c12224'&gt;&lt;img align='right' height='200' width='300' src='http://farm4.static.flickr.com/3389/3442434899_ff38c06cb0_b.jpg'/&gt;&lt;/a&gt;I started with simply connecting my camera to the binoculars by pressing them together and trying to focus automatically.&lt;/p&gt;    &lt;p&gt;This did not work at all, the camera had big problems with finding a focus so I changed to manual focussing and tried to get a good result by holding the binoculars in the left hand, my camera in the right, pressing both together and trying to focus the binoculars AND the camera. I failed miserably!&lt;/p&gt;    &lt;p&gt;It is impossible to do all this together when you hold all this stuff in your hands. I placed the construction on an appropriate surface and  had the opportunity to focus the both separate systems.       &lt;/p&gt;    &lt;p&gt;&lt;a href='http://flickr.com/gp/crazy-ivory/cXbCb7'&gt;&lt;img align='right' border='50' height='200' width='300' src='http://farm4.static.flickr.com/3587/3442488279_94aa131005_b.jpg'/&gt;&lt;/a&gt; There was only one unpleasant thing in all this. Due to  the  fact that I had to place all this on a plane surface to be  able to have any positive influence on the results it wasnt possible to change the shooting angle. That means that the camera stood on a handrail that was parallel to the ground and there was nothing I could do against that.&lt;/p&gt;    &lt;p&gt;As you can imagine this is a very limitation in a creative process.&lt;/p&gt;    &lt;h1&gt; &lt;/h1&gt;    &lt;h1&gt; &lt;/h1&gt;    &lt;h1&gt;the interesting parts of this technique:&lt;/h1&gt;    &lt;p&gt;There are many points that I really liked about the resulting images. I will try to name and explain them and to show you images that visualize that.&lt;/p&gt;    &lt;h1&gt;sharpness&lt;/h1&gt;    &lt;p&gt;&lt;a href='http://flickr.com/gp/crazy-ivory/29n1yG'&gt;&lt;img align='left' height='200' width='300' src='http://farm4.static.flickr.com/3540/3443319242_c81793a41a_b.jpg'/&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;a href='http://flickr.com/gp/crazy-ivory/f3Pa7y'&gt;&lt;img align='right' height='200' width='300' src='http://farm4.static.flickr.com/3304/3443309760_a0ef7ac4b7_b.jpg'/&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/p&gt;    &lt;p&gt; &lt;/p&gt;    &lt;p&gt; &lt;/p&gt;    &lt;p&gt; &lt;/p&gt;    &lt;p&gt; &lt;/p&gt;    &lt;p&gt; &lt;/p&gt;    &lt;p&gt;                                &lt;/p&gt;    &lt;p&gt;                                                                                                &lt;/p&gt;    &lt;p&gt;To achieve a real sharp image it needs a bunch of practicing time and patience to learn it. But why must it be a sharp image all the time? Most of my own results were not sharp at all but that made them not worse in any kind of way. Many of them looked very abstract, you could only guess what they show and the way that the blurred lights look like is just awesome(see the "unsharp" image for better understanding). All in all the sharpness is probably the most challenging part of this technique but also the most interesting. It is just funny to try around with different focus settings and to see how the bokeh parts look like.&lt;/p&gt;    &lt;p&gt; &lt;/p&gt;    &lt;h1&gt;distort&lt;/h1&gt;    &lt;p&gt;&lt;a href='http://flickr.com/gp/crazy-ivory/CYK4DJ'&gt;&lt;img align='middle' height='200' width='300' src='http://farm4.static.flickr.com/3562/3443269908_b667afb59b_b.jpg'/&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/p&gt;    &lt;p&gt;The distortion of the images is quite interesting and pretty different to the ones of other techniques IMO. It mostly concentrates on the background while the foreground is not so clearly distorted. You can increase or reduce the effect by changing the distance of the camera and the binoculars. The distortion effect looks a bit like motion blur in some kind of way. I think the best is if you form your own opinion with the help of the image further up.&lt;/p&gt;    &lt;h1&gt;colors&lt;/h1&gt;    &lt;p&gt;&lt;a href='http://flickr.com/gp/crazy-ivory/8K3TwR'&gt;&lt;img height='200' width='300' src='http://farm4.static.flickr.com/3319/3442446731_ceea4770ce_b.jpg'/&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/p&gt;    &lt;p&gt;Colors are defined very desaturated. I worked with the 18-55mm which is probably the worst lens of canon but even this one produces more colorful images when used  normally. The effect that is produced has a nostalgic and old feeling to it but all who dont like that can compensate this with color correction in post processing.&lt;/p&gt;    &lt;h1&gt;vignette&lt;/h1&gt;    &lt;p&gt;&lt;a href='http://flickr.com/gp/crazy-ivory/8xen2g'&gt;&lt;img align='right' height='200' width='300' src='http://farm4.static.flickr.com/3604/3443233376_a2f8f3bd0c_b.jpg'/&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;a href='http://flickr.com/gp/crazy-ivory/xhSUtZ'&gt;&lt;img align='left' height='200' width='300' src='http://farm4.static.flickr.com/3658/3442444977_51ee2c1557_b.jpg'/&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/p&gt;    &lt;p&gt; &lt;/p&gt;    &lt;p&gt; &lt;/p&gt;    &lt;p&gt; &lt;/p&gt;    &lt;p&gt; &lt;/p&gt;    &lt;p&gt; &lt;/p&gt;    &lt;p&gt; &lt;/p&gt;    &lt;p&gt; &lt;/p&gt;    &lt;p&gt;A big point because it is really hard to produce results that dont show any sign of vignetting. The best way is to learn to work with them. As you can see further up the    strengths  of vignettes vary obviously clear and give a totally different effect to the particular images. As you can imagine the vignette effect is enhanced when the camera-binoculars distance is magnified. If you put the lens as close as possible and in the center of the peephole this vignette is only a shadow that is not clearly visible. I really liked the different ways these vignettes appeared because you had various opportunities what to do with them. As you can see in the second picture you can let it look like you would look through something or not.&lt;/p&gt;    &lt;p&gt; &lt;/p&gt;    &lt;h1&gt;Summary&lt;/h1&gt;    &lt;p&gt;A very interesting and different technique that is worth to be tried.&lt;/p&gt;    &lt;p&gt;With this technique you can achieve very interesting and unique effects. You can change these effects by yourself with changing things like the distance of binoculars and lens, changing the focus of either the camera or the bicoculars, changing the focal distance or to put the camera in a little       sharp angle to the binocular to get a distorted image.
